In this article, we will talk about Samsung HW-LST70T vs Sony HT-S40R comparison. The Samsung HW-LST70T was rated 6.4, while the Sony HT-S40R has a rating 5.2.
Each of the models under consideration has active amplification type. A noticeable difference is the number of channels that HW-LST70T has 3.0 and HT-S40R has 5.1. These rivals can be compared in terms of power, 210 (overall) versus 600 (overall) according to devices. A built-in subwoofer is available only in the Samsung HW-LST70T. An external subwoofer connects to the HW-LST70T via wireless, but HT-S40R has wired connection type. Rate 6 out of 10 received the Samsung HW-LST70T for audio features and specs, but the Sony HT-S40R received 7 out of 10.
Soundbars do not have AirPlay support. The HW-LST70T can play audio from Spotify.
Wireless Internet connection is realized only in the HW-LST70T. Soundbars from this comparison have Bluetooth support. There are 1/0 HDMI inputs/outputs in the Samsung HW-LST70T versus 0/1 HDMIs in the Sony HT-S40R. The HDMI Audio Return Channel (ARC) is implemented only in the HT-S40R. Connecting devices via USB is possible in both models. We rated the connectivity of the HW-LST70T at 6 out of 10, while the HT-S40R was rated 7/10. The manufacturer of the HW-LST70T provides a device control application. The Samsung HW-LST70T equipped with a microphone. The Samsung HW-LST70T may become part of a multiroom system.
Dolby Atmos audio decoder support is not implemented in either the HW-LST70T or HT-S40R. Devices from this comparison cannot process surround sound due to lack of DTS:X. The HW-LST70T was rated 5/10, while the HT-S40R received a mark of 8/10 for multichannel surround.
